What are the key technologies for producing A4 stickers?

2025-02-15 15:15
1

The key technologies for producing A4 stickers mainly include the following aspects:


1、 Design and layout technology

Size and error control: The size of A4 stickers needs to be strictly controlled, and the error should be kept within a small range (such as 0.5mm) to ensure the accuracy and applicability of the labels.

Printing layout design: The printing layout should be consistent with the specific design product, including the position and size of elements such as text, images, barcodes, as well as the accuracy of overprinting (with an error controlled within 1.5mm), to ensure the beauty and readability of the label.

2、 Printing technology

Choose the appropriate printing process: Based on the material, design requirements, and purpose of the label, choose the appropriate printing process, such as embossing, offset printing, screen printing, hot stamping, UV printing, etc. These processes can achieve different printing effects, such as raised text, metallic texture, special colors, etc.

Ink and color management: Choose ink suitable for adhesive materials to ensure bright, long-lasting, and non fading colors. At the same time, color management is carried out to ensure that the printed colors are consistent with the original design.

3、 Material selection and processing technology

Selection of base paper and surface material: The surface material thickness of the base paper should be uniform to ensure the uniformity of mold cutting and the speed of waste discharge. The surface material is selected according to the purpose and requirements of the label, such as paper, PET (polyester film), PVC (polyvinyl chloride), etc.

The selection of adhesive: The symmetry of the adhesive coating directly affects the separation force between the label and the backing paper, which in turn affects the application effect of the label and the speed of the equipment. Therefore, it is necessary to choose raw materials that are suitable for the amount of glue and silicon coating.

4、 Die cutting and forming technology

Die cutting process: The adhesive label is cut into the desired shape and size using a die cutting machine to adapt to specific application scenarios. The precision and speed of die-cutting are crucial for improving production efficiency and label quality.

Waste discharge and disposal: During the die-cutting process, a large amount of waste is generated. These waste materials need to be discharged and processed in a timely manner to avoid pollution and damage to the production environment and equipment.

5、 Quality control technology

Appearance inspection: Conduct a visual inspection of the printed A4 adhesive to ensure that the surface is clean, free of adhesion, shadows, dirt, and other defects.

Performance testing: Testing the adhesion, waterproofness, wear resistance, etc. of the label to ensure that it meets the usage requirements.
